Abstract :
This paper deals with Cole model parameter identification in bioimpedance spectroscopy. A new method for the selection of test frequencies is proposed. The evaluation of the sensitivity functions versus frequency for the unknown parameters is employed. The sensitivity magnitude is used as a criterion for the test frequency selection.
